Olympic Village - Port Olympic

The Olympic Village (La Vila Olímpica del Poblenou) is a neighbourhood in the district of Sant Marti in Barcelona built for the 1992 Summer Olympics in Barcelona to house the athletes participating in the event. It was the first maritime district in Barcelona, the buildings of which were mostly designed by the architects of the MBM company: Oriol Bohigas, Josep Maria Martorell, David Mackay and Albert Puigdomènech. Apart from the residential buildings, also a shopping centre Icaria and a marina called Port Olympic were built. Port Olympic is situated at the foot of the two tallest skyscrapers in Barcelona, which were built during the renovation of Barcelona coastal area for the 1992 Olympic Games.

The neighbourhood has a large promenade and plenty of bars and restaurants. This is why, at night the residential area transforms into a leisure centre, particularly around the Olympic Port and the Paseo Marítimo. The nearest beach the Nova Icaria, is one of the most crowded beaches in Barcelona.
